I'm no metallurgist so forgive my ignorance. Most of
us have had the problem of interfacing copper to
aluminum. Is there some sort of alloy terminal block
that will accomplish that feat? Seems simple enough
to create an alloy that gradually transitions from
copper to aluminum but what do I know?


The problems are mostly the different thermal coefficients of expansion
and surface oxidation of Al. Galvanic corrosion can also be an issue.

If you are talking about home brew stuff, the general solution is to
clean, apply anti-oxide grease, and connect under compression, i.e.
something with a tightening screw.
